Origins and Functionality

The origins of the hoodie can be traced back to the early 20th century when it was first introduced as a functional garment for athletes and laborers. The term “hoodie” derives from the word “hood,” referring to the officialstussy attached head covering that sets it apart from other sweatshirts and jackets. Initially designed to provide warmth and protection from the elements, the hoodie quickly gained popularity due to its practicality.

Real-world Example: Champion’s Hooded Sweatshirt

One notable example of an early hoodie design is Champion’s Hooded Sweatshirt, introduced in the 1930s. Made from heavyweight fleece, it featured a drawstring hood and a front kangaroo pocket, offering both comfort and functionality. This classic design laid the foundation for future hoodie iterations.

From Function to Fashion

As the years went by, hoodies transitioned from being purely functional to incorporating elements of fashion. The 1970s witnessed a significant turning point when hoodies became associated with urban street culture and were adopted by subcultures such as skateboarders and hip-hop artists.

Real-world Example: Shawn Stussy’s Stüssy Hoodie

In the 1980s, the Stüssy Hoodie by Shawn Stussy emerged as a pioneering design that bridged the gap between sportswear and streetwear. The iconic Stüssy logo, coupled with bold graphics and vibrant colors, transformed the hoodie into a fashion statement. This influential design paved the way for countless streetwear brands that followed.

Innovation and Technological Advancements

With the advancement of technology and the rise of athleisure, hoodie designs have continually evolved to meet the demands of modern consumers. Innovative materials, construction techniques, and functional features have transformed hoodies into versatile pieces of clothing suitable for various occasions.

Real-world Example: Nike Tech Fleece Hoodie

Nike’s Tech Fleece Hoodie showcases the fusion of style and performance. Constructed with lightweight and insulating Tech Fleece fabric, it offers superior comfort while providing optimal warmth. The ergonomic design and articulated sleeves allow for unrestricted movement, making it a popular choice among athletes and fashion enthusiasts alike.

Cultural Impact and Expression

Hoodies have transcended their practical origins to become symbols of cultural identity and self-expression. They have been embraced by diverse communities, allowing individuals to convey their personal style and affiliations.

Real-world Example: Supreme Box Logo Hoodie

The Supreme Box Logo Hoodie exemplifies the cultural significance of hoodies within streetwear and youth culture. The simple diorhoodie.com yet instantly recognizable box logo on the chest has become a highly sought-after emblem of style, exclusivity, and authenticity. This iconic design has sparked a global phenomenon and established Supreme as a leading streetwear brand.
